Sample Coding Exercise
To get this project to work you will need to add the api.json file to the root directory of the project (Sent to recruiter)
Challenges
- Ive never used the Yelp API
- I was running short on time and took short cuts to get images to display
If I hade more time I would have
- Polished the UI, it needs more work..
- Fixed the way I am loading imaged, I put an extension on UIImageView but ideally i would like to be able to have more control of the image task
- Added suggestions/autofill - Yelp has a nice API for autofill that would be very nice with a UISearchController
- My location manager isnt great either, I dont like how i set it up it depends a lot on timing and could cause problems
- Error handling needs improvment